The Best Order For Using Skin Care Products

The order in which you apply skincare products is important to ensure maximum efficacy and absorption of active ingredients. Here's a general guideline for the recommended order of skincare products:

Cleanser

Start with a gentle cleanser to remove dirt, oil, and impurities from the skin. Choose a cleanser suitable for your skin type (e.g., gel cleanser for oily skin, cream cleanser for dry skin).

Toner (Optional):

 If you use a toner, apply it after cleansing to help balance the skin's pH levels and remove any remaining traces of dirt or makeup. Look for alcohol-free toners with hydrating or soothing ingredients.

Treatment Products:

Apply treatment products that target specific skin concerns, such as acne, hyperpigmentation, or aging. These products often contain active ingredients like retinoids, AHAs (alpha hydroxy acids), BHAs (beta hydroxy acids), vitamin C, or niacinamide. Apply them in order of thinnest to thickest consistency.

    • Serums: Serums typically have a lightweight, fluid texture and contain high concentrations of active ingredients. Apply serums with targeted benefits, such as hydrating, brightening, or anti-aging serums.

    • Spot Treatments: If you use spot treatments for acne or blemishes, apply them after serums but before moisturizers to target specific areas of concern.

  1. Eye Cream: Apply eye cream to the delicate skin around the eyes to hydrate, firm, and address concerns like dark circles or puffiness. Use your ring finger to gently tap the product around the orbital bone, avoiding direct contact with the eyes.

  2. Moisturizer: Apply a moisturizer to hydrate and nourish the skin, locking in moisture and providing a protective barrier. Choose a moisturizer suitable for your skin type (e.g., lightweight gel for oily skin, rich cream for dry skin) and apply it evenly to the face and neck.

  3. Sunscreen (Morning Routine): In the morning, finish your skincare routine with a broad-spectrum sunscreen to protect the skin from UV damage and prevent premature aging. Choose a sunscreen with an SPF of 30 or higher and apply it generously to all exposed areas of skin.

    • If you're using a physical sunscreen (with ingredients like zinc oxide or titanium dioxide), apply it after moisturizer. If you're using a chemical sunscreen, apply it before moisturizer to ensure proper absorption.
  4. Facial Oil (Optional): If you use facial oil as part of your skincare routine, apply it as the final step to lock in moisture and provide additional nourishment to the skin. Use a few drops of oil and gently press it into the skin, focusing on dry or areas of concern.

It's important to wait a few minutes between each step to allow the products to fully absorb into the skin before applying the next layer.
